Output 27a98c2cdeb6f8e3a705e9f53d4230862a33a7dc5febcfcd890dfd67aa2debff:0

value
667111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0437cac55824806558c2a67ebebe159ab25b434e OP_EQUAL
address
325KTp4thBqXH9QSMg1F1gcJotLBmwnc2z
transaction
27a98c2cdeb6f8e3a705e9f53d4230862a33a7dc5febcfcd890dfd67aa2debff
confirmations
521810
spent
true